Adiabatic quantum computing simulation with gap tracking and optimization.

This module implements adiabatic quantum computation (AQC), a model of quantum computation that uses the adiabatic theorem to solve optimization problems. The system starts in the ground state of a simple Hamiltonian and slowly evolves to a final Hamiltonian whose ground state encodes the solution.
